The first home football game of the season is this tonight at 7 p.m., and it’s Senior Night.

Seniors from organizations involved in football games such as players, cheer, Student Council, and Charms will be honored either before the game, during halftime, or after the game. Each senior will be announced as they walk across the field escorted by their parents. The Student Council and Senior Parent Organization are helping put on this event.

“It’s a great opportunity to honor all of our amazing seniors,” Student Council President Caroline Klein said. “Not only do we get to be honored for Senior Night, we also get to help put it on for everyone else.”

In light of the unique circumstances this year, many are looking forward to Senior Night.

“For four years I’ve been building up to this moment,” senior middle linebacker Mickey Nolen said. “It’s exciting to be on the field as a senior.”

COVID-19 has created much uncertainty surrounding the football season, so having this annual Senior Night game is a boost in morale for seniors.

“This is our first game this season that we are cheering at,” senior cheerleader Autumn Kashin said. “Over the summer we assumed we wouldn’t have a season, so [the game] is a big deal.”
